Another option is Fastmail.fm.  I'm a long-time satisfied
customer, and as of about two weeks ago, I'm using them for all my
personal e-mail.  I finally gave up on hosting my own after nearly
a decade of doing so, and am feeling quite relieved.  They have a
strong focus on standards-compliance and security.  Their Web
interface is highly functional yet remains clean and requires no
Javascript interpretation.  MDA is Sieve, and you can either use
their simplified GUI or edit your script directly.

It's $15 - $60 per user per year for business accounts:

<http://www.fastmail.fm/help/business_business.html>

They use SpamAssassin, optionally with a per-account Bayes
database which takes effect after you've reported 200 messages as
spam and 200 as non-spam.
